设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 239|回复: 4
打印 上一主题 下一主题

[有事请教] 关于战斗中切换背景的方法

[复制链接]

Lv1.梦旅人

梦石
0
星屑
190
在线时间
23 小时
注册时间
2023-12-31
帖子
6
跳转到指定楼层
1
发表于 2024-1-26 10:37:49 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
20星屑
萌新在用vs的插件,求教大佬们,怎么在战斗中,用技能然后切换背景图或者动态背景

最佳答案

查看完整内容

对插件Visual Battle Environment帮助文本的汉化: (需要用公共事件调用它的插件命令来执行各种动态背景操作) ============================================================================ 介绍 ============================================================================ 为您的战斗系统添加额外的图像层,用于背景或前景目的。这些图像可以是战斗背景、图片、视差, 或者您需要的任何东西。为它们添加额外的设置, ...

Lv2.观梦者

梦石
0
星屑
916
在线时间
188 小时
注册时间
2023-7-14
帖子
86
2
发表于 2024-1-26 10:37:50 | 只看该作者
对插件Visual Battle Environment帮助文本的汉化:
(需要用公共事件调用它的插件命令来执行各种动态背景操作)

============================================================================
介绍
============================================================================

为您的战斗系统添加额外的图像层,用于背景或前景目的。这些图像可以是战斗背景、图片、视差,
或者您需要的任何东西。为它们添加额外的设置,例如滚动、混合模式、不同的不透明度级别、色调等等。

功能包括以下所有(但不限于)内容:

* 创建位于战斗者后面的战斗环境图像,用作背景的一部分。
* 创建位于战斗者前面的战斗环境图像,用作前景的一部分。
* 为它们应用自定义设置,例如改变它们的混合模式、滚动速度和不透明度级别。
* 自定义它们的色调,以及是否有色调变化。
* 如有需要,应用颜色色调以获得更多颜色控制。
* 在战斗中途更改它们的不透明度级别。
* 可以添加到战斗场景中的无限数量的背景环境和前景环境。
* 环境图像根据它们的ID分层。较低的ID出现在下方,较高的ID出现在上方。

============================================================================
要求
============================================================================

该插件适用于RPG Maker MZ。这在RPG Maker的其他版本中无法工作。

------ 所需插件列表 ------

* VisuMZ_1_BattleCore

要使此插件工作,必须在游戏的插件管理器列表中安装上述列出的插件。如果没有列出的插件,
您无法启用此插件来开始游戏。

------ 第2层 ------

该插件是第2层插件。将其放在插件管理器列表中其他较低层级值的插件下方(即:0, 1, 2, 3, 4, 5)。
这是为了确保您的插件与VisuStella MZ库的其余部分具有最佳兼容性。

============================================================================
插件命令
============================================================================

以下是随本插件提供的插件命令。它们可以通过插件命令事件命令访问。

---

=== 背景环境类型插件命令 ===

---

Back Environment: Add/Change(背景环境:添加/更改)
- 添加/更改目标背景环境。

  设置:

    ID:
    - 选择要添加/更改的目标环境ID。
    - 较低的ID出现在下方。较高的ID出现在上方。

    Folder and Filename(文件夹和文件名):
    - 文件夹和文件名是什么?

  Extra Settings(额外设置):
  - 可以更改的额外设置,用于环境对象。
  - 详情请参阅下面的部分。

    Duration(持续时间):
    - 更改设置需要多少帧?

---

Back Environment: Fade Opacity(背景环境:淡化不透明度)
- 将目标背景环境的不透明度淡化到不同的值。

  ID(s)(ID):
  - 目标是哪个背景环境?
  - 不能目标默认的战斗背景。

  Target Opacity(目标不透明度):
  - 将此值的不透明度调整到多少(0-255)。
  - 您可以使用JavaScript代码来确定该值。

  Duration(持续时间):
  - 这个更改应该持续多少帧?
  - 您可以使用JavaScript代码来确定该值。

---

Back Environment: Remove(背景环境:移除)
- 移除目标背景环境。

  ID(s)(ID):
  - 移除哪个背景环境?
  - 不能移除默认的战斗背景。

---

=== 前景环境类型插件命令 ===

---

Front Environment: Add/Change(前景环境:添加/更改)
- 添加/更改目标前景环境。

  设置:

    ID:
    - 选择要添加/更改的目标环境ID。
    - 较低的ID出现在下方。较高的ID出现在上方。

    Folder and Filename(文件夹和文件名):
    - 文件夹和文件名是什么?

  Extra Settings(额外设置):
  - 可以更改的额外设置,用于环境对象。
  - 详情请参阅下面的部分。

    Duration(持续时间):
    - 更改设置需要多少帧?

---

Front Environment: Fade Opacity(前景环境:淡化不透明度)
- 将目标前景环境的不透明度淡化到不同的值。

  ID(s)(ID):
  - 目标是哪个前景环境?
  - 不能目标默认的战斗背景。

  Target Opacity(目标不透明度):
  - 将此值的不透明度调整到多少(0-255)。
  - 您可以使用JavaScript代码来确定该值。

  Duration(持续时间):
  - 这个更改应该持续多少帧?
  - 您可以使用JavaScript代码来确定该值。

---

Front Environment: Remove(前景环境:移除)
- 移除目标前景环境。

  ID(s)(ID):
  - 移除哪个前景环境?
  - 不能移除默认的战斗背景。

---

=== 额外设置 ===

---

额外设置
- 这些设置用于“背景环境:添加/更改”和“前景环境:添加/更改”插件命令。

  外观:

    Scale Style(缩放样式):
    - 用于此环境图像的缩放样式。
      - Battle Core Setting(战斗核心设置)
      - MZ(MZ的默认样式)
      - 1:1(无缩放)
      - Scale To Fit(缩放以适应屏幕大小)
      - Scale Down(如果大于屏幕则向下缩放)
      - Scale Up(如果小于屏幕则向上缩放)

    Opacity(不透明度):
    - 此图像的不透明度是多少?
    - 您可以使用JavaScript代码。

    Blend Mode(混合模式):
    - 您希望将哪种混合模式应用于图像?
    - 您可以使用JavaScript代码。
      - Normal(正常)
      - Additive(添加)
      - Multiply(乘)
      - Screen(屏幕)

    Hue(色调):
    - 您希望调整此图像的色调吗?
    - 您可以使用JavaScript代码。

    Hue Shift(色调变化):
    - 您希望每帧色调变化多少?
    - 您可以使用JavaScript代码。

    Color Tone(颜色调):
    - 您希望背景的色调是什么?
    - 格式:[红色,绿色,蓝色,灰色]

  滚动:

    Horizontal Scroll(水平滚动):
    - 水平滚动速度是多少?
    - 使用负值反转方向。

    Vertical Scroll(垂直滚动):
    - 垂直滚动速度是多少?
    - 使用负值反转方向。
回复

使用道具 举报

Lv2.观梦者

梦石
0
星屑
916
在线时间
188 小时
注册时间
2023-7-14
帖子
86
3
发表于 2024-2-1 08:43:03 | 只看该作者
本帖最后由 catxiaolang 于 2024-2-1 09:20 编辑



静态背景用自带的公共事件设置就可以,在第三页。
做好后用技能执行这个公共事件。

visu插件的战斗核心(Visu Battle Core)只是对这个功能进行了优化:
默认情况下,更改战斗背景事件命令在战斗中不起作用。对其的任何设置只会在下一场战斗中反映出来。现在,如果在战斗中使用了战斗背景事件命令,它将立即反映任何新的更改。



动态背景要用到另外一个visu插件:
Visual Battle Environment

网址:
http://www.yanfly.moe/wiki/Visua ... nment_VisuStella_MZ
回复

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
190
在线时间
23 小时
注册时间
2023-12-31
帖子
6
4
 楼主| 发表于 2024-2-2 06:31:01 | 只看该作者
catxiaolang 发表于 2024-2-1 09:11
对插件Visual Battle Environment帮助文本的汉化:
(需要用公共事件调用它的插件命令来执行各种动态背景操 ...

阿里嘎多,玛玛哈哈!
回复

使用道具 举报

Lv2.观梦者

梦石
0
星屑
916
在线时间
188 小时
注册时间
2023-7-14
帖子
86
5
发表于 2024-2-2 12:07:30 | 只看该作者
青烟绕梦城 发表于 2024-2-2 06:31
阿里嘎多,玛玛哈哈!

能帮助到就好,几个月前我也在论坛问了相同的问题
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-4-28 00:04

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表